How they compare
Denmark currently reports 71.4% against 71.0% in France, a difference of 0.4%.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 23 shared years of data; in 1995 it was Denmark ahead.
Denmark ranks 35th and France ranks 36th of 111 countries.
Denmark has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Denmark | France |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 65.3% | 49.8% | 15.5% | Denmark |
| 2000s | 71.3% | 56.4% | 14.9% | Denmark |
| 2010s | 70.0% | 69.2% | 0.8% | Denmark |
| 2020s | 71.8% | 71.0% | 0.8% | Denmark |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
